In the Alps, they accompanied livestock, pulled carts, stood watch, and provided their owners with loyal companionship. Breeders are required to have all the test results, whether positive or negative, documented in the CHIC database before any Berners are issued a CHIC number. Some Berners breeders set up the Berner-Garde Foundation to help improve the breeds health by collecting and sharing information about some of the genetic diseases that affect Berners. As a working dog, Berners enjoy having a job to accomplishwhether its pulling a cart in drafting events or collecting toys in the yard.
